Nawabpura

Nawabpura is a village located in Jirapur tehsil of Rajgarh district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Jirapur (tehsildar office) and 45km away from district headquarter Rajgarh. As per 2009 stats, Padliya is the gram panchayat of Nawabpura village.

About Nawabpura

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nawabpura is 478802. The village spans a total geographical area of 367.58 hectares. Jirapur is nearest town to Nawabpura village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Nawabpura

Below is a concise population overview of Nawabpura as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 575 294 281
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 99 51 48
Scheduled Castes (SC) 191 98 93
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 203 124 79
Illiterate Population 372 170 202

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Nawabpura village:

  • The total population of Nawabpura village is around 575, including approximately 294 males and 281 females, with a sex ratio of 955 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 99 children aged 0–6 years in Nawabpura village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Nawabpura village has 191 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Nawabpura village is about 35.30%, with male literacy at 42.18% and female literacy at 28.11%.
  • There are around 113 households in Nawabpura village.

Connectivity of Nawabpura

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nawabpura. As per the 2011 stats, Nawabpura had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
